Output 76bc1215fc1d6aa0ed130bbdbba5c7be59661f3dc73af0005068228889103b2b:1

value
644772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e725d186bf6c5ca50c9de077fff785ef9e95fc0c OP_EQUAL
address
3NmDKXfBvwjhPvUSQ2L8p2ux14DEi5Mny9
transaction
76bc1215fc1d6aa0ed130bbdbba5c7be59661f3dc73af0005068228889103b2b
spent
true